Query 1: Is a normal two-car storage ample for incorporating a practical workshop?
The story is advised of builders who tried to shoehorn a full workshop into a normal footprint. The end result? A cramped, unusable house the place automobiles scraped towards workbenches and instruments lay scattered throughout the ground. A regular two-car storage not often accommodates each vehicular storage and a practical workshop with out compromising usability. Extra sq. footage is almost at all times a necessity.
Query 2: What’s the minimal depth required for a workshop space inside a two-car storage?
The narrative unfolds of an artisan whose preliminary plans lacked ample workshop depth. Their workbench overhung the automobile bay, forcing them to consistently rearrange instruments and supplies. A minimal depth of not less than 10-12 toes is usually really helpful to accommodate gear and permit for protected, environment friendly motion.
Query 3: How does ceiling top impression workshop performance?
The story recounts the expertise of an automotive fanatic who opted for a low ceiling to avoid wasting on building prices. Quickly after, he found his engine hoist was unusable with out vital modification. Commonplace ceiling heights can prohibit the forms of initiatives that may be undertaken. Larger ceilings enable for the set up of lifts, present space for storing, and accommodate taller gear.
Query 4: What’s the really helpful door width for every automobile bay?
There may be an account of a house owner who constructed a two-car storage, solely to seek out that his full-size truck might barely squeeze by way of the doorways. A door width of not less than 9 toes per bay is suggested to accommodate most automobiles comfortably. Bigger automobiles could require even wider openings.
Query 5: How a lot aisle house is critical for protected and environment friendly workshop operation?
The cautionary story includes a woodworker whose slim aisles led to a number of accidents and close to misses. Ample aisle house prevents congestion and minimizes the chance of harm. A minimal of three toes of aisle house is really helpful round workbenches and gear.
Query 6: Are there any particular constructing codes that have an effect on storage and workshop dimensions?
The anecdote is shared of a builder who did not seek the advice of native constructing codes, leading to expensive revisions and building delays. Native constructing codes can stipulate minimal setbacks, most constructing heights, and different dimensional necessities. Consulting with native authorities is crucial earlier than commencing building.
